The Hyogo Performing Arts Center (兵庫県立芸術文化センター), located in Nishinomiya near Hankyu Nishinomiya-Kitaguchi Station, is one of the area’s main performing arts hubs. The venue hosts a wide range of performances including classical concerts, opera, ballet, theatre, and contemporary dance.

Designed as a large-scale arts complex with multiple halls, the center is easy to get to from both Kobe and Osaka, and works well as a destination stop for an evening performance or a full arts-focused day. The complex is connected to the train station, and is surrounded by a range of shops and restaurants.

Getting there

The center is located in Nishinomiya and is directly connected to Hankyu Nishinomiya-Kitaguchi Station by a pedestrian deck (about a 2-minute walk). It’s a convenient trip from both Kobe and Osaka by train. For navigation, plug “Hyogo Performing Arts Center” into your maps app.
